  • Page 8: Description Of The Clamping Device

    Improper use and clamping with too high torques will cause damage to the spindle and jaws. Function The clamping range can be quickly adjusted by turning the spindle with a hand crank. The KSX-C2 can be extended for an even larger clamping range with additional pull rod extensions. schunk.com XND.00041.002_B – 05/2022...
  • Page 9: Operation (Standard Operation)

    The base plate is fitted with an interface to attaching the clamping pin for the VERO-S quick-change palleting system. The KSX-C2 can also be produced at the factory with customer-specific positioning and fixing holes as well as with location recesses for various commonly available quick-change palleting systems.

  • Page 11: Clamping Procedure

    Important: The cylinder screw must be tightened to 140 Nm and it must not clamped without the workpiece, as otherwise the carrier jaws could shift and could damage the base plate. Precision clamping KSX-C2 125 Precision clamping KSX-C2 125-L schunk.com...
  • Page 12: Raw Workpiece Clamping (With Lift-Off)

    Significantly higher clamping forces are achieved with the raw workpiece clamping. Make sure that the torque of 100 Nm is not exceeded to overload the clamping system in the long run. Raw part clamping KSX-C2 125 and KSX-C2 125-L schunk.com XND.00041.002_B – 05/2022...

  • Page 14: Disasembly / Assembly Of The Spindle

    The spindle is completely encapsulated and the maximum stroke is marked (3). Important: The thread must not be turned above the limit line marking (3), as a spindle that is opened too far can break out during clamping. schunk.com XND.00041.002_B – 05/2022...
